+Rockchip SoC MIPI RX D-PHY
+-------------------------------------------------------------
+
+Required properties:
+- compatible: value should be one of the following
+	"rockchip,rk3288-mipi-dphy"
+	"rockchip,rk3399-mipi-dphy"
+- clocks : list of clock specifiers, corresponding to entries in
+	clock-names property;
+- clock-names: required clock name.
+- #phy-cells: Number of cells in a PHY specifier; Should be 0.
+
+MIPI RX D-PHY use registers in "general register files", it
+should be a child of the GRF.
+
+Optional properties:
+- reg: offset and length of the register set for the device.
+- rockchip,grf: MIPI TX1RX1 D-PHY not only has its own register but also
+		the GRF, so it is only necessary for MIPI TX1RX1 D-PHY.
